Gluten Free Pasta Sauce Upgrade
This is how we "upgrade" our favorite gluten free pasta sauce
Ingredients
- 1 White Onion Chopped
- 1 Red Pepper Chopped
- 3 cloves Garlic fresh pressed
- 1 tbsp Bragg's Seasoning
- 2 tsp Sea Salt
- 2 tsp Black Pepper
- 2 Jimmy Dean Sauages
- 2 jars Classico pasta sauce
Instructions
-
Saute the onion, pepper, and garlic while adding the salt, pepper, and Bragg's seasoning
-
Add the pork sausage and brown the meat. No need to drain!
-
Once meat is fully cooked, pour in pasta sauce and mix. Bring to boil then simmer on low heat for 15 minutes
